New Location of The Great Greek Mediterranean Grill in Fort Worth

The Great Greek Mediterranean Grill, where fans of fresh Mediterranean cuisine can be transported to Greece through the vibrant flavors of elevated traditional dishes, opened a new location at 9654 Red Dirt Road in the Shops at Chisholm Trail. The 2,200-square-foot restaurant is owned by a local family of military veterans, Cliff Bowling and his two sons, Daniel and Patrick Bowling, who also opened the restaurant’s first Fort Worth location in the Crestwood-area last year.

Afrah Mediterranean Restaurant in Richardson

Shiah Tawook

Afrah Mediterranean Restaurant, located in the heart of Richardson, TX, is a beacon for lovers of authentic Mediterranean cuisine. What started as a humble pastry shop in 2002 by three brothers has since evolved into a vibrant restaurant known for its rich flavors, warm hospitality, and an extensive menu that reflects the culinary traditions of Lebanon and the greater Mediterranean region.

SanabelS Opens In Addison

by Steven Doyle

A new restaurant, SanabelS, just opened their doors in Addison in the former Ciao Chicago location at 15107 Addison Road.
